Hong Kong Milk Tea Gains Popularity Across TikTok in the USA

Hong Kong milk tea and its flavors are making waves on TikTok in the USA, with the trend spreading across Europe. While the culinary scene boasts a variety of global cuisines, the city’s traditional diner-style cafés, known as “cha chaan tengs,” continue to capture the locals’ fascination.

These establishments offer affordable versions of regional favorites, including macaroni and noodle soups, fried egg sandwiches, and buttery French toast. A staple accompaniment is milk tea, or “lai cha,” a rich, dark-tan beverage crafted from black tea blends meticulously brewed to extract maximum strength, combined with evaporated or condensed milk.

Though the milk tea trend may be subsiding, dessert establishments are capitalizing on its popularity by introducing new, themed items. Among the viral Hong Kong milk tea desserts are:

Shaved Ice with Thai Milk Tea: ChaTraMue has introduced a dessert called Thai Milk Tea Shaved Ice, featuring biscuit puffs, grass jelly, and condensed milk tea sauce, creating a refreshing and flavorful treat.

Bubble Milk Tea Avalanche Cake: A best-seller from Miss Marble, this cake features layers of Japanese flour chiffon cake and Twinings Earl Grey tea-infused cream, creating a visually appealing cascade when the plastic lid is removed.

Milk Tea Macarons: Jouer, founded by Le Cordon Bleu graduate Anne Cheung, offers creative macaron varieties, including the Hong Kong Milk Tea Macaron, capturing the essence of cha chaan teng flavors.

Milk Tea Red Bean Ice: Caring Tea in Tsim Sha Tsui modernizes the classic red bean ice by adding milk tea, presenting a stylish twist on regional drinks with a visually stunning skyline-adorned cup.

As the TikTok community continues to explore and appreciate Asian culinary delights, Hong Kong milk tea remains at the forefront, captivating audiences worldwide.
